Web14 de ago. de 2024 · Because they are selling a tenanted property, they are required to give you 24 hours notice of any scheduled viewings. Landlords have the right to show the property to potential buyers between 8AM and 8PM, provided the appropriate 24 hours notice is given. WebIf you are covered by the guideline, and the landlord wants to increase your rent by more than the guideline, then the landlord must apply to the Landlord and Tenant Board (LTB). The Notice of Rent Increase should be on a Form N1. The government has released a standard lease form – Residential Tenancy Agreement (Standard Form of Lease). This form must be used for most private residential tenancy agreements that are entered into on or after April 30, 2024.
